The County of Kauai offers low interest Residential Rehabilitation Loans for qualifying homeowners. For more information contact the Housing Agency at 241-4444.

Low-Income Rate Assistance
Hawaiian Electric Co.
A new decision by the PUC allows the total amount of electricity used by qualifying low-income customers to be billed at the lowest rate tier. Eligible customers must provide a copy of their qualification letter for the federally funded Low Income Home Energy Assistance Program.

Low-Income Energy Efficiency
Kauai Island Utility
Cooperative
Qualifying Member Appliance Replacement Program
The purpose of this program is to help qualifying low-income seniors (age 60+) reduce their residential electricity use by replacing older, less efficient refrigerators and defective electric water heaters with new, more efficient ones at no cost to the member. Qualified participants must own their homes, own the refrigerator and meet federal poverty guidelines for the program year. The refrigerator to be replaced must be at least 11 years old and be the primary refrigerator. There can be no additional refrigerators in the home. This program is offered in partnership with the County of Kauai. Members must contact the County of Kauai Offices of Community Assistance Agency on Elderly Affairs to determine eligibility.
